Barley HvBODYGUARD1 controls cuticular specialisations regulated by SHINE transcription factors.

Land plants secrete a protective outer cuticular layer with diverse functions. Barley (Hordeum vulgare L.) develops two cuticular specialisations: the β-diketone rich wax bloom on vegetative tissues and an adherent grain surface which sticks to the hulls, leading to barley's distinctive 'covered' grain phenotype.
